Rowans Close, Longfield house prices
The typical home in Rowans Close, Longfield last sold for £265,000, based on the official HM Land Registry record. Over the past decade prices are +83% in cash — but +29% once inflation is stripped out.

Recent sales in Rowans Close, Longfield
The most recent homes sold here, straight from the HM Land Registry record.
| Date | Address | Type | Price | £/m² |
|---|---|---|---|---|
| 5 Jan 2018 | 10 Rowans Close · DA3 7QU | Detached Freehold | £520,000 | £4,063 |
| 14 Aug 2014 | 9A Rowans Close · DA3 7QU | Detached Freehold | £370,000 | £3,458 |
| 21 Jan 2011 | 6 Rowans Close · DA3 7QU | Detached Freehold | £377,500 | — |
| 17 Dec 2003 | 9 Rowans Close · DA3 7QU | Semi-detached Freehold | £294,000 | — |
| 11 Jul 2003 | 9A Rowans Close · DA3 7QU | Detached Freehold | £275,000 | £2,570 |
| 27 Mar 2002 | 2 Rowans Close · DA3 7QU | Detached Freehold | £189,950 | £1,900 |
| 31 Jan 2002 | 7 Rowans Close · DA3 7QU | Detached Freehold | £265,000 | — |
| 13 Aug 2001 | 10 Rowans Close · DA3 7QU | Detached Freehold | £229,000 | £1,789 |
| 11 May 2001 | 6 Rowans Close · DA3 7QU | Detached Freehold | £250,000 | — |
| 17 Oct 1997 | 7 Rowans Close · DA3 7QU | Detached Freehold | £155,000 | — |
| 19 Mar 1997 | 9A Rowans Close · DA3 7QU | Detached Freehold | £120,000 | £1,121 |
Category A (standard) sales. £/m² shown where an EPC floor-area match exists.
Biggest price gains in Rowans Close, Longfield
Homes that have changed hands more than once, ranked by their annual return — in cash and, where we have the inflation data, after adjusting for it.
| Address | First sold | Last sold | Times | Cash return | Real return |
|---|---|---|---|---|---|
| 7, Rowans Close | £155,000 17 Oct 1997 | £265,000 31 Jan 2002 | 2 | +13% per year | +11% inflation-adjusted |
| 9A, Rowans Close | £120,000 19 Mar 1997 | £370,000 14 Aug 2014 | 3 | +7% per year | +4% inflation-adjusted |
| 10, Rowans Close | £229,000 13 Aug 2001 | £520,000 5 Jan 2018 | 2 | +5% per year | +3% inflation-adjusted |
| 6, Rowans Close | £250,000 11 May 2001 | £377,500 21 Jan 2011 | 2 | +4% per year | +2% inflation-adjusted |
Category A (standard) sales that changed hands at least twice. Real return adjusts for inflation using ONS CPIH where available.
